Output dd66f84a5d961d25bdcfc012867725d03bc622ec60b71e2ed15d8b9547500efa:2

value
1813802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b0499a3a3b5b0dc90dd63f10561b94b01a8d83c OP_EQUAL
address
35cUVR84ZtintTtEnhVyd9bTe6bVTDDWWw
transaction
dd66f84a5d961d25bdcfc012867725d03bc622ec60b71e2ed15d8b9547500efa
spent
true